def get_container(self, path): """Return single container.""" if not settings.container_permitted(path): raise errors.NotPermittedException( 'Access to container "%s" is not permitted.' % path) return self._get_container(path)
def get_container(self, path): """Return single container.""" if not settings.container_permitted(path): raise errors.NotPermittedException( "Access to container \"%s\" is not permitted." % path) return self._get_container(path)
def get_containers(self): """Return available containers.""" permitted = lambda c: settings.container_permitted(c.name) return [c for c in self._get_containers() if permitted(c)]